Kid’s Closet Places Third in National Contest

Kids Closet_01Kid’s Closet, which collects clothing and school supplies for kids in Starke County, has received $6,500 after finishing third in an online poll. Safeco Insurance’s Make More Happen Contest awarded grants to 33 organizations nationwide who had been nominated by local insurance agencies.
Each organization got $3,000. Plus, since the contest surpassed its goal of 28,000 votes, the organizations each got another $500. On top of all that, Kid’s Closet got another $3,000 for finishing third.
Kid’s Closet founder and director Linda Lewandowski says the money will help the organization buy clothing and school supplies throughout the year, “This means we will have the funds to purchase the things that we do not have in stock. We do have a lot of gently used clothes in stock, but many times we don’t have the size that a child needs, so we have to go shopping for that need.”
The organization was nominated by Carrie Block from First Choice Insurance. She says winning third place in a national contest says a lot about the local community, “Being a small community, I didn’t know if we would even have a chance to be in the running, trying to advertise and get the word across our community. I just had no idea where we might be able to place, and week after week as I saw the results coming in, I was just completely blown away that we were able to accomplish that.”
Kid’s Closet is a ministry of North Judson United Methodist Church and serves children throughout Starke County.
